Why Organize a DIDay?
Digital Independence Day is a great opportunity to bring people in your community together and support them in switching to digital alternatives.
Getting Started
- Choose a Date - The first Sunday of a month is traditionally DIDay
- Find a Location - A local café, community center, or online meetup
- Build a Team - Find supporters who want to help
- Register Your Event - Sign up at events.diday.org and create your event
- Promote - Share your event on social media and local networks
What You’ll Need
- Laptops/tablets with internet access
- Snacks and beverages for a relaxed atmosphere
Tips for a Successful Event
- Keep groups small and personal
- Offer hands-on sessions for different focus areas
- Document your event with photos, if all participants agree
- Share experiences with the community
